ADD · Addis Ababa
Ethiopian Airlines Group · Bole International, Terminal 2
Walk-in entry
Ethiopian sells a lounge access pass online, via its app, at ticket offices and at the airport, but publishes no rate on its lounge page or its lounge-access page. No price in ETB or USD could be verified from a qualifying source; the widely-quoted USD 50 appears only in aggregator guides.
Paid walk-in also accepted.
Passengers holding a Cloud Nine business class outbound boarding pass. Access from 5 hours before departure.
Cloud-9 Lounge at Bole International accepts 2 access programmes: Airline Access, Paid Walk-in. 1 of the 2 access rules here is airline- or cabin-class-specific, so a boarding pass in the right class can be enough on its own. Each rule on this page lists its own guest policy and any spend or cabin conditions attached to it.
Cloud-9 Lounge operates 24 hours daily. Lounges frequently close earlier than posted on quiet days and during terminal works, and last entry is often 30–45 minutes before closing — check before a late or early connection.
Cloud-9 Lounge is in Terminal 2 at Bole International (ADD) in Addis Ababa, Ethiopia, operated by Ethiopian Airlines Group. Lounges sit airside, so you must clear security — and in most cases be in the same terminal — before you can use it.
It depends which rule you enter on — 1 of the 2 access rules at Cloud-9 Lounge permits guests. Guest allowances are set by the programme, not the lounge, so the same lounge can admit your partner free on one card and charge on another.
Verified facilities at Cloud-9 Lounge: Wi-Fi, Buffet, Hot food, Showers, Business centre, Quiet room, Children's area. Facilities vary by time of day — hot food and bar service in particular are often limited outside peak hours.
